Context
In this hadith, Hudhaifa narrates an encounter with angels who question a deceased individual about their good deeds. The individual recalls their practice of leniency in financial dealings, particularly towards those in need. The Prophet Muhammad (ﷺ) highlights the importance of compassion and generosity in financial matters, illustrating how such actions can lead to divine mercy.
